Web16 aug. 2024 · For decades, tax guidance has required the accrual method for those maintaining inventory. Since most fabricators have inventory, the default accounting method has been the accrual method. Under those provisions, fabricators would record revenue and expenses when incurred, not when cash was received or paid. WebManaging inventory.
